    Pharoah Sanders - Tenor Sax
    Eddie Henderson - Flugelhorn
    John Hicks - Piano
    Ray Drummond - Bass
    Idris Muhammad - Drums
    Dee Dee Dickerson, Bobby McFerrin, Vicki Randle, Ngoh Spencer - Vocals

    Cm9-Dm7-Gm7-Am7. Rinse. Repeat. How they manage to keep four chords interesting for almost severn minutes is beyond my comprehension, but they surely do. John Hicks (p), Ray Drummond (b), Idris Muhammad (d). BTW, one of the singers is Bobby McFerrin, a couple of years before he recorded his first album.
